I. Choosing the Right Monitoring System:

[Insert Image: Variety of speedboat monitoring systems - GPS trackers, cameras, sensor arrays]

Before beginning installation, carefully select the monitoring system that best suits your needs and budget. Consider factors like:
GPS Tracking: Essential for location awareness and anti-theft measures. Choose a tracker with a robust signal and long battery life. Look for features like geofencing and real-time tracking capabilities.
Cameras: Enhance security and situational awareness. Consider waterproof and high-resolution cameras suitable for marine environments. Night vision is beneficial for low-light conditions.
Sensors: Monitor vital parameters such as engine temperature, fuel level, battery voltage, and bilge water levels. Alert systems for critical thresholds are highly recommended.
Remote Access: Ensure your chosen system allows remote access via a mobile app or web interface for convenient monitoring and control.
Data Storage and Connectivity: Consider data storage capacity and the type of connectivity (cellular, satellite) that best suits your boating areas.


II. Preparing for Installation:

[Insert Image: Tools required for installation - wire cutters, crimpers, screwdrivers, drill]

Gather the necessary tools and materials before starting. This typically includes:
Appropriate wiring and connectors
Drill with various drill bits
Screwdrivers (Phillips and flathead)
Wire strippers and crimpers
Cable ties and zip ties
Waterproof sealant and marine-grade tape
Protective gloves and eyewear

Ensure the boat's power is turned off before commencing any electrical work. Familiarize yourself with the boat's wiring diagrams to avoid damaging existing systems.

III. Installing the GPS Tracker:

[Insert Image: Step-by-step pictorial of GPS tracker installation, showing wire routing and secure mounting]

Typically, GPS trackers require a power source and an antenna with a clear view of the sky. Securely mount the tracker in a hidden location, protecting it from the elements. Route the wiring carefully, avoiding sharp edges and potential pinch points. Connect the power source according to the tracker's specifications, ensuring proper polarity.

IV. Installing Cameras:

[Insert Image: Step-by-step pictorial of camera installation, showing mounting brackets and cable routing]

Choose suitable mounting locations for the cameras, considering the desired field of view and protection from damage. Use marine-grade mounting brackets to ensure secure attachment. Run the camera cables neatly and securely, using cable ties and protective conduits where necessary. Seal all connections to prevent water ingress.

V. Installing Sensors:

[Insert Image: Step-by-step pictorial of sensor installation, showing sensor placement and wiring]

Install sensors according to their specific instructions. For example, temperature sensors should be mounted close to the engine but protected from direct contact with hot surfaces. Fuel level sensors are typically installed in the fuel tank. Ensure all connections are secure and properly sealed against moisture.

VI. Connecting to the Power Source:

[Insert Image: Diagram showing the power distribution and connections for the monitoring system]

Connect all components to a reliable power source. Use appropriately sized fuses to protect the system from overloads. Consider using a separate circuit breaker for the monitoring system to prevent power surges from affecting other systems on the boat.

VII. Testing and Troubleshooting:

[Insert Image: Screenshot of the monitoring system interface, showing data from all sensors and cameras]

After installation, thoroughly test the entire system. Check all sensors for accurate readings, ensure camera feeds are clear, and verify that the GPS tracker is providing accurate location data. Consult the manufacturer's instructions for troubleshooting any issues. If problems persist, seek professional assistance.

VIII. Maintenance:

Regularly check the system for any loose connections, corrosion, or damage. Clean the cameras and sensors as needed. Keep the software updated to benefit from improvements and bug fixes. Proper maintenance will ensure the longevity and effectiveness of your speedboat monitoring system.
